TRIO Adventure Challenge also adheres to the seven central tenets of the Leave No Trace philosophy:
• Plan Ahead and Prepare
• Travel and Camp on Durable Surfaces
• Dispose of Waste Properly
• Leave What You Find
• Minimize Campfire Impacts
• Respect Wildlife
• Be Considerate of Other Visitors
Our initial concern is to ensure that every event has minimal environmental impact. Race organizers and participating teams and registered press and spectators are required to read and agree to environmental guidelines developed specifically for each event. Guidelines explain and provide examples of the need to dispose of waste properly, ways to reduce the usage of non-recyclable goods, and guidelines on items to reuse throughout the events.
